Lady Senators drop home contest to Chattanooga State
MORRISTOWN, TN – Walters State fell at home to Chattanooga State on Thursday, dropping a 3-0 (25-17, 25-17, 25-23) contest to the Lady Tigers.
With the loss, the Lady Senators fell to 7-10 on the season and 2-3 in TCCAA play.
Walters State got up 3-1 in the opening set after a kill and block by Veda Barton and ace by Lilabeth Jordan, and the lead was extended to 6-4 after back-to-back kills by Davanie Tarleton. Tarleton had another kill to make it 7-5, but Chattanooga State took the lead at 10-9.
Walters State tied the set at 11, but Chattanooga State rallied off six straight points. Isabelle Brickey stopped the run with a kill, and Barton had back-to-back kills that made it 18-14. However, Chattanooga State surged again and took the set at 25-17.
Set two saw Chattanooga State take an early lead. Brickey got Walters State on track with a kill that cut it to 9-6. However, the Lady Tigers built a nine-point lead and went up 17-8. Walters State tried to close the gap but could not, falling 25-17.
The third set was close throughout. The two teams were tied at four, five, seven and eight before Walters State rallied off two points. Chattanooga State tied it back up and then led 13-11, but Barton had back-to-back kills to even things up at 13. Walters State took a 16-14 lead after kills from Destani Bailey and Barton, and then led 20-17 thanks to back-to-back kills by Kara Coggins.
Unfortunately for Walters State, Chattanooga State surged ahead 23-20. Walters State made one final charge with back-to-back points on a kill by Chloe Redwine and a block by Tarleton, but Chattanooga closed the set and match out.
